Ellie

Being a single mom is the most challenging, yet rewarding job I’ve ever had. Especially in a small town, where everyone knows your story, or at least their version of it.


They say it takes a village, and they’re right. I’ve been lucky to have close friends to help me raise my son, Brody. One particular friend stands out above the rest. TD stepped up in a big way, teaching my son everything a father should. That’s why his friendship means so much to me. Both Brody and I rely on his friendship. Any feelings I have for my sexy friend must stay buried. It’s safer that way.

Turns out, it’s much harder to do when he decides he’s done being just my friend. He wants more.


TD

There’s nothing worse than being in lust with one of your friends. For years, I’ve been fighting my attraction to Ellie and keeping it a secret. I thought I was doing what was best for all of us.

Between working as the local police officer and coaching high school football, I’m left with very little downtime, but what I do have is spent with Ellie and her son. When I find out the seventeen-year-old boy might be working to get this football coach and his mom together, all bets are off. With Brody on my side, I’m willing to take the chance and blur the lines between friends and lovers.

I have to make her see we can have it all. Despite her reservations, I’ll show her love is worth the risk.
